Advancements In Surgical Training Models

surgical training models play a crucial role in the education and preparation of future surgeons. These models are designed to provide hands-on experience and simulate real-life surgical procedures in a controlled environment. With advancements in technology and medical education, these training models have become more sophisticated and effective in preparing surgeons for the operating room.

One of the key benefits of surgical training models is their ability to provide a safe and controlled environment for learning. Before entering the operating room, aspiring surgeons can practice their skills and techniques on these models, reducing the risk of errors during actual surgery. This hands-on experience allows trainees to become more comfortable and confident in their abilities, ultimately leading to better patient outcomes.

There are several types of surgical training models available, each serving a specific purpose in the education of surgeons. Simulation-based models, for example, use advanced technology to replicate surgical procedures in a realistic way. These models often incorporate virtual reality and haptic feedback to create a fully immersive learning experience for trainees. By practicing on these simulation models, surgeons can refine their skills and improve their understanding of complex surgical techniques.

Anatomical models are another type of surgical training model that is commonly used in medical education. These models provide a detailed representation of the human body’s anatomy, allowing trainees to practice procedures on lifelike structures. By working with these anatomical models, surgeons can develop a better understanding of the body’s internal structures and how they interact during surgery. This knowledge is essential for performing successful procedures and minimizing the risk of complications.

Cadaveric models are also widely used in surgical training programs to provide trainees with a hands-on experience of working with real human tissue. These models offer a unique opportunity for surgeons to practice surgical techniques on actual human organs and structures. By dissecting and manipulating cadaveric tissue, trainees can gain valuable insight into the complexities of the human body and develop their skills in a realistic setting.

In recent years, virtual reality has emerged as a powerful tool for surgical training. Virtual reality simulators can recreate surgical scenarios in a highly realistic and interactive manner, allowing trainees to practice procedures in a safe and controlled environment. These simulators offer a cost-effective and convenient way for surgeons to hone their skills and improve their performance without the need for expensive equipment or live tissue.

Another innovative approach to surgical training models is the use of 3D printing technology. By creating custom-made anatomical models from patient-specific imaging data, surgeons can practice procedures on accurate replicas of real patient anatomy. These 3D-printed models allow trainees to plan surgeries in advance, simulate complex procedures, and improve their surgical skills in a tailored and patient-specific way.
